Long-term stationary studies on the ecology of the northern mole vole (Ellobius talpinus Pall.), performed by the mark–recapture method from 1985 to 1997, have provided original data on population dynamics and structure. The analysis shows that, to reveal cyclic fluctuations of population size in this species, the period of three years should be taken as a unit of time for estimating the duration of one phase. The 12-year population cycle in E. talpinus has four distinct phases: an increase, a peak, a decline, and a minimum. At each phase, the population is characterized by certain features of family structure, age composition, birth and death rates, and the composition of migrants. 相似文献

以南京江北新区分流制雨水管道沉积物为研究对象,考察不同粒径沉积物中铵态氮(NH3-N)和硝态氮(NO3--N)干期分布特征,分析其随干期长度的变化关系,并探讨沉积物理化性质及微生物菌群结构对NH3-N和NO3--N干期分布的影响.结果表明:粒径≤0.075mm的沉积物中NH3-N占比最高(交通区30.8%,商业区36.7%);交通区粒径≤0.075mm的沉积物中NO3--N占比最高(33.0%),而商业区粒径0.075~0.15mm沉积物中NO3--N占比最高(34.4%);干期长度与交通区0.075~0.15mm粒径段的沉积物中NO3--N含量及商业区粒径≥0.3mm的沉积物中NH3-N含量之间的相关性均最显著;雨水管道沉积物中NH3-N和NO3--N的干期分布与O-H和N-H等官能团、表面极性和亲水性、微观形貌等有一定关联;交通区雨水管道沉积物中Gemmobacter等反硝化优势菌种(相对丰度总和为20.15%)对NO3--N干期分布影响更显著. 相似文献

Inhaled atmospheric fine particulate matter(PM_(2.5)) includes soluble and insoluble fractions,and each fraction can interact with cells and cause adverse effects.PM_(2.5) samples were collected in Jinan,China,and the soluble and insoluble fractions were separated.According to physiochemical characterization,the soluble fraction mainly contains watersoluble ions and organic acids,and the insoluble fraction mainly contains kaolinite,calcium carbonate and some organic carbon.The interaction between PM_(2.5) and model cell membranes was examined with a quartz crystal microbalance with dissipation(QCM-D) to quantify PM_(2.5) attachment on membranes and membrane disruption.The cytotoxicity of the total PM_(2.5) and the soluble and insoluble fractions,was investigated.Negatively charged PM_(2.5) can adhere to the positively charged membranes and disrupt them.PM_(2.5)also adheres to negatively charged membranes but does not cause membrane rupture.Therefore,electrostatic repulsion does not prevent PM_(2.5) attachment,but electrostatic attraction induces remarkable membrane rupture.The human lung epithelial cell line A549 was used for cytotoxicity assessment.The detected membrane leakage,cellular swelling and blebbing indicated a cell necrosis process.Moreover,the insoluble PM_(2.5) fraction caused a higher cell mortality and more serious cell membrane damage than the soluble fraction.The levels of reactive oxygen species(ROS) enhanced by the two fractions were not significantly different.The findings provide more information to better understand the mechanism of PM_(2.5) cytotoxicity and the effect of PM_(2.5) solubility on cytotoxicity. 相似文献

The toxicity of the water-soluble fraction (WSF) of four fuels (leaded gasoline, unleaded gasoline, diesel, Jet A-1) to Metamysidopsis insularis, an indigenous tropical mysid species was determined. Approximately 10 000 barrels (bbl) of fuel are consumed daily in Trinidad and Tobago, and about 50 000 bbl are exported. Accidental discharges at points of transfer as well as from inadequate storage facilities, can pose a significant contamination risk to the environment. Organisms were assayed with the WSF under both UV and fluorescent lights. The WSF was prepared using different fuel/seawater (v/v) mixtures. It was found that organisms exposed to diesel, Jet A-1 and unleaded gasoline showed similar toxicological responses under both light regimes, and were more toxic than the leaded gasoline. The results also showed that none of these fuels show photo-induced toxicity. The WSF of the 0.1% mixtures of unleaded gasoline, diesel and Jet A-1 were acutely toxic to M. insularis. However, for the leaded gasoline, only the 0.5% mixture was acutely toxic. The high toxicity of these fuels may be due to the presence of light, more soluble fractions. It is therefore likely that these fuels will have significant impacts in our local environment, if any spills occur. 相似文献

In the present study, the sorption of pyrene on two kinds of bulk paddy soils, Gleyic Stagnic Anthrosols, and Ferric accumulic Stagnic Anthrosols as well as their particle-size fractions was investigated. The sorption isotherms fitted well with Freundlich equation. For both soils, the clay fraction( 〈 2μm) and coarse sand fraction(2000-250μm) had higher sorption capacity than fine sand fraction(250-20 μm) and silt fraction(20-2 μm). The IogKoc values obtained of each soil and its particle-size fractions were similar, proving that SOM content was a key factor affecting pyrene sorption. The Kd values showed a significant correlation with contents of dithionite-extractable Fe in both paddy soils and a good relationship with CEC in Gleyic Stagnic Anthrosols, indicating possible effects of surface properties of particle-size fractions on the sorption of pyrene. 相似文献

膜生物反应器膜污染的水力学控制实验研究 总被引:1,自引:0,他引:1
叙述了膜污染是影响膜-生物反应器处理技术推广应用的关键因素,采用水动力学方法是控制膜污染的有效方法。在不同污泥浓度条件下。对不同曝气强度下膜污染的发展速率及其形成机理进行了试验研究,研究结果表明:对应于不同污泥浓度均存在一个经济曝气强度,其大小随污泥浓度升高呈线性增加,膜生物反应器在经济曝气强度条件下运行可控制膜污染的发展;并从理论上推导出一个临界污泥浓度,其值为5.15g/L。对应于临界污泥浓度,并且污泥絮体在膜面可形成比较稳定的动态膜,膜过滤压差上升的速率最慢,膜生物反应器在此临界污泥浓度条件下运行膜污染发展最为缓慢。 相似文献

Data from 2907 transcervical CVS cases performed on singleton pregnancies were reviewed retrospectively and villus sample size was correlated with cytogenetic results, placental location, maternal age at the expected date of confinement (EDC), gestational age at the time of sampling, birth weight, gestational age at the time of delivery, and pregnancy outcome. No correlation was noted between villus sample size and maternal age, gestational age at sampling, gestational age at delivery, birth weight, or pregnancy outcome. An inverse correlation between villus sample size and percentage of abnormal cytogenetic findings was statistically significant (X2 = 8·53, p <0·01). The percentage of small samples was greater when the placenta was anterior, lateral, or fundal than when the placenta was posterior. 相似文献

通过连续提取法对电镀废水污染区和对照区农田土壤中的重金属元素Cu、Cr、Ni、Pb和Mn形态进行了研究.结果显示,污染区土壤中多种形态的Cu、Cr和Ni含量都显著高于对照区,尤其以它们的有机结合态差异最为显著.污染区较对照区土壤中Mn的总量虽无显著差异,但可交换态Mn的含量显著增加(分别为98.68mg/kg和40.75mg/kg).污染区与对照区土壤中的Pb的交换态、碳酸盐结合态、Fe-Mn氧化物结合态、有机结合态和残留态均无显著差异.电镀废水的污染使得农田土壤中Cu、Cr和Ni含量和生物有效性显著升高,Mn的化学形态改变,移动性和生物有效性增加. 相似文献

对影响葫芦岛市城区环境质量可吸入颗粒物的各类污染源颗粒物的粒度成份、分布特征进行分析。采用斯托克直径ds(Stoke's Diameter)表示法,利用巴柯离心机对样品进行处理,得到各类排放源所排放的不同粒径的颗粒物重量百分比,为环境管理提供科学依据。 相似文献
